This quiet 16-acre residential area offers spacious living on tree-lined streets, with many homes featuring generous lots and cul-de-sac settings perfect for families seeking room to spread out. The neighborhood provides a peaceful suburban atmosphere while maintaining convenient access to dining and daily needs, with 13 restaurants within walking distance and several grocery options nearby.
Residents enjoy excellent transit connectivity and easy access to outdoor recreation, including the nearby Brian Dyk Nature Preserve and seven other parks within a mile. The area is served by Grand Rapids Public Schools, with the top-rated nearby school earning strong marks. With an ownership rate of 55% and walkout patios overlooking terraced backyards, this area appeals most to families and professionals who value quiet residential living with convenient urban amenities and outdoor spaces for relaxation.
